3-2 Setup

The principal setup operations before operating this unit
can be carried out using setup menus.
The setup menus of this unit comprise a basic setup menu
and an extended setup menu. The contents of these menus
are as follows.
Basic setup menu:
• Items relating to the hours meter
• Items relating to operation
• Items relating to menu banks
Extended setup menu:
• Items relating to control panels
• Items relating to the remote control interface
• Items relating to editing operations
• Items relating to preroll
• Items relating to disc protection
• Items relating to the time code, metadata, and UMID
• Items relating to video control
• Items relating to audio control
• Items relating to digital processing
For detailed information about the items, except for the
basic menu items relating to the hours meter, of these
menus and how to use them, see Chapter 8 "Menus" (page
101). For detailed information about menu operations
relating to the hours meter, see 9-1-1 "Digital Hours
Meter" (page 133).
This unit allows four different sets of menu settings to be
saved in what are termed "menu banks" numbered 1 to 4.
Saved sets of menu settings can be recalled for use as
required.
For more information about the menu banks, see "Menu
bank operations (menu items B01 to B13)" (page 107) and
the description of maintenance menu item "SETUP
MAINTENANCE" – "SETUP BANK4" (page 125).

3-3 Setting the Date and
Time
When using this unit for the first time, you should set the
date and time as follows.

Holding down the SHIFT button, press the MENU
button.
The system menu appears on the monitor screen.
2
Select "DATE/TIME PRESET" using the F button or
f button, then press the g button.
The date and time setting screen appears on the
monitor, allowing you to set the following items.
• YEAR: Calendar year
• MONTH: Month
• DAY: Day
• TIME: Time
• TIME ZONE: Time zone (Difference from UTC)
3
Set the date, time and time zone.
You can change the setting of the flashing digits.
To change the flashing digits
Use the arrow buttons (G, g).
To increase or decrease the values of the flashing
digits
Use the arrow buttons (F, f) or jog dial.
4
Press the SET button.
The date, time and time zone settings are stored.
To return to the previous menu page
Press the MENU button.
To exit the menu
Press the MENU button twice in succession.
